When: Thursday, September 16 at 5pm Where: O'Donnell Park – Downtown Milwaukee
Copy: Each year teams of families, friends, co-workers come together to raise funds for The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society's “Light The Night” walk and bring help and hope to people battling blood cancers.
“Light The Night” events are evenings filled with inspiration. During this leisurely walk, walkers carry illuminated balloons - white for survivors, red for supporters and gold in memory of loved ones lost to cancer - thousands of walkers - men, women and children - form a community of caring, bringing light to the dark world of cancer.
